White bread is made from a type of bread flour that is processed from wheat. Processing removes the bran and germ: parts of the wheat grain. Whole wheat will generally be darker and denser, since it contains more nutrients and more fiber. These two aspects are great for digestion and give your body the nutrition it needs. White bread has a nice mild flavor but is made from just the endosperm of the wheat grain, and has less nutritional value. Instead, choose whole grain bread, which is rich in essential nutrients.

In general, processed meats contain few nutrients that are associated with negative medical outcomes when consumed in excess. Meat processing sometimes includes the addition of nitrates and nitrites, which have been linked to an increased risk of cancer when consumed in moderation. Sodium is also incorporated into processed meats at fairly significant levels. Whenever possible, cook and eat fresh meat.
Like eating sweets, sugary cereals often contain a lot of simple carbohydrates and sugars and less protein, fiber and vitamins. As a breakfast option, sugary cereals can also lead to… Crashes blood sugar Which makes you feel hungry shortly after taking the pills. Choosing low-sugar cereals that contain more protein and fiber, as well as plant-based milks or dairy products, can help you feel full and energized for longer.
